我想为Surface开发一个WinRT应用程序。
有一个我在任何地方都找不到的细节。我是否可以使用Windows 7在设备上编译和运行,或者我需要升级到Windows 8?
答案 0 :(得分:7)
不,您无法在Windows 7上开发RT“现代”风格的应用程序。您需要将Windows 8安装为主操作系统或托管在VM中。
答案 1 :(得分:1)
有可能在Windows 7中使用虚拟机(Win8)进行开发,如果您想在没有虚拟机的情况下进行开发,则必须升级它
答案 2 :(得分:0)
不直接,不。 WinRT应用程序需要Windows 8 API,不支持在Windows 7上构建它们。您可以通过设置虚拟机并对其进行开发来伪造环境。
答案 3 :(得分:-1)
从Microsoft Surface SDK文档:
" Microsoft Surface 2.0 SDK提供了托管API以及开发Surface应用程序所需的工具。使用Surface SDK构建的应用程序可以在为Surface 2.0和Windows 7计算机制作的设备上运行......"
在此处阅读更多内容:http://msdn.microsoft.com/en-us/library/ff727815.aspx